首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用于编码竞赛的C编码评估员

以下是关于用于编码竞赛的C编码评估员的完善且全面的答案:

名词概念

C编码评估员是一种用于编码竞赛的自动评分系统,它可以自动接收参赛者的代码,并根据预先设定的评分标准和规则,对参赛者的代码进行评分。

分类

C编码评估员可以分为以下几类:

  1. 基于规则的评估器:这种评估器根据预先设定的规则,对参赛者的代码进行评分。
  2. 基于测试用例的评估器:这种评估器根据预先设定的测试用例,对参赛者的代码进行评分。
  3. 基于评价函数的评估器:这种评估器根据预先设定的评价函数,对参赛者的代码进行评分。

优势

  1. 自动化:C编码评估员可以自动接收参赛者的代码,并根据预先设定的评分标准和规则,对参赛者的代码进行评分,节省了评委的时间和精力。
  2. 客观性:C编码评估员可以根据预先设定的评分标准和规则,对参赛者的代码进行客观的评分,避免了人为因素的影响。
  3. 准确性:C编码评估员可以根据预先设定的评分标准和规则,对参赛者的代码进行准确的评分,避免了人为因素的影响。

应用场景

C编码评估员可以应用于以下场景:

  1. 编程竞赛:C编码评估员可以用于编程竞赛,对参赛者的代码进行评分,确定获胜者。
  2. 在线教育:C编码评估员可以用于在线教育,对学生的代码进行评分,帮助学生了解自己的学习情况。
  3. 课程评估:C编码评估员可以用于课程评估,对学生的代码进行评分,帮助老师了解学生的学习情况。

推荐的腾讯云相关产品和产品介绍链接地址

  1. 腾讯云云函数:https://cloud.tencent.com/product/scf
  2. 腾讯云容器服务:https://cloud.tencent.com/product/ccs
  3. 腾讯云API网关:https://cloud.tencent.com/product/apigateway
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

香农编码matlab实现实验总结_香农编码C语言

理解信源编码意义; 熟悉 MATLAB程序设计; 掌握哈夫曼编码方法及计算机实现; 对给定信源进行香农编码,并计算编码效率; 二、实验原理介绍 1、把信源符号按概率…… 哈夫曼编码实验报告_数学_自然科学...掌握利用MATLAB实现香农编码 二…… 形式提供给用户,这些函数可方便调用,并具有多种 循环,条件语句控制程序流向,从而使程序完全结构化.[3] 实验目的编写一个可以实现对一组概率进行香农编码程序...3页 1财富值 通… 此程序缺点是,第 一个码字都是以 0 开始,因为对累加概率求二进制后,小数点后数都是 0,取 1 信息论与编码实验报告 几位由码长确定,而香农编码是不唯一…… 0.05??...进行二进制香农编码。 3.自已选择一个例子进行香农编码。 五、实验设备 PC 计算机 ,C++ 文档大全 实用标准 六、实验报告要求 1、画出程序设计流程图…… pi i?1n H(x)=??...发布者:全栈程序栈长,转载请注明出处:https://javaforall.cn/195199.html原文链接:https://javaforall.cn

1.2K10

用于大规模视频流硬件编码架构

视频引擎架构 使用案例 用于视频编码可组合基础设施 移动云游戏 新编码技术需求 不同视频应用需求 视频传输占据了互联网流量主要部分。...不同应用场景有不同需求,视频编码、转码也在不断提出新需求 VOD 在分发前预先编码,大量视频内容需要可扩展高密度、节能、低成本编码; 直播流与交互式视频需要实时编码; 高交互性应用需要低延迟编码...per Stream 58W 11W w/o b, 27W w/ b 3W Codensity 视频引擎架构 NETINT Codensity 视频引擎在上层提供了 FFmpeg libavcodec 用于视频编码和...libavfilter 插件用于一些视频 2d 操作,也提供了一些 FFmpeg AI plugin,用于例如 ROI 和背景检测替换一些特性,便于整合到现有的工作流。...AV1, HEVC, H.264 2D scaling / overlay graphics engine AI DNN engine 进一步提升密度,降低 TCO 使用案例 用于视频编码可组合基础设施

90230
  • 编码之道(一):程序圣经

    从本周起,我将阐述我对编码之道理解与思考,这是第一篇:程序"圣经" 技术只是工具 由于我过去经历,我编码经验遍历后端,移动端以及前端,所以我清楚几乎每一个方向程序日常工作是怎么样。...做为一个程序,我从来不对特定语言表达虔诚,但我想程序也得有自己虔诚,我想要寻找一个编码"圣经",它足以让我虔诚遵守它,守护它,捍卫它。...这便是程序"圣经" 三个原则 我认为做为一个程序,最神圣就是三个原则,它几乎能完整无误定义做为一个程序应该如何去编码。 它也不是空洞理论,每一个原则都是可以通过技术实实在在做到。...这三个原则就是程序"圣经", 它们分别是: 编写满足需求代码 编写可维护代码 编写易于阅读代码 编码满足需求代码 这应该非常易于理解。...下一步就是使命,你有没有思考过这一个问题,做为一个程序编码使命是什么? 下一篇,继续谈编码之道:编码之道(二):编码使命

    57130

    良好代码格式反映了程序编码能力,好程序应该这么编码

    注释双斜线与注释内容之间有且仅有一个空格。...正例:下例中实参 args1,后边必须要有一个空格。...单个方法总行数不超过 80 行。 说明:包括方法签名、结束右大括号、方法内代码、注释、空行、回车及任何不可见字符总 行数不超过 80 行。...没有必要增加若干空格来使某一行字符与上一行对应位置字符对齐。 不同逻辑、不同语义、不同业务代码之间插入一个空行分隔开来以提升可读性。 说明:任何情形,没有必要插入多个空行进行隔开。...感谢大家在百忙之中看完了小编文章,喜欢就点个订阅吧。小编都会分享程序那些事,还有干货哦!

    90610

    编码之旅:C++基础韵律

    前言 这是我自己学习C++第一篇博客总结。后期我会继续把C++学习笔记开源至博客上。 C++兼容性 1....区别于 typedef 关键字,typedef 关键字用于给类型取别名,而引用用于给变量取别名。 4. 引用可以用来代替往函数里面传地址操作。...2. inline对于编译器而言只是⼀个建议,inline适用于频繁调用短小函数,对于代码相对多⼀些函数,加上inline也会被编译器忽略。 3. ...C语言宏本质就是在编译时候进行替换,C语言实现宏函数也会在预处理时替换展开,但是宏函数实现很复杂很容易出错,且不方便调试。C++设计了inline目的就是替代C宏函数。...程序通常会用0或NULL来表示一个空指针。但是这种方式存在一些潜在问题,主要是因为0和NULL实际上是整数常量,在某些情况下可能会导致意外类型转换。 2.

    5400

    编码之道(终):做专业程序

    但我认为,如果需要用一个词来做为我们职业上想要达到境界,我更喜欢专业这个词。 它几乎能包含一切其它词语。 本周,编码之道最终章,做专业程序。...本系列其它文章为: 编码之道(一):程序"圣经" 编码之道(二):软件价值 编码之道(三):编码困境,失衡价值 编码之道(四):编码有术,术中有道 编码之道(五):变化术,及永恒编码之道...(六):程序修"道"之路 编码初心 你还记得你为什么会选择编程这个事?...在Robert C.Martin《程序职业素养》这本书中,有两个章节我觉得非常契合这个理念,其中一个是说不,另外一个是承诺。...并且希望能有更多程序一起去不断探索编程这个事,把编程这件事做更好。 所以,编码之道这个系列,我与自己许下一个约定: 十年后再见

    69310

    编码之道(六):程序修道之路

    程序对具体技术掌握的确很重要,因为程序就是使用这些技术来编码代码。但真正决定一个程序能力及未来可朔性,只能是编码之道。 那究竟做为一个程序,我们要如何追求编码之道呢?...本周,继续聊编码之道,这是第六篇,本系列其它文章为: 编码之道(一):程序"圣经" 编码之道(二):软件价值 编码之道(三):编码困境,失衡价值 编码之道(四):编码有术,术中有道 编码之道...也就是当下一步你去寻找工作,或被评估时,别人如果问你一个React什么机制或技术点,你就会很清晰回答上来。 这种程度,你就足以让别人认为你是一个优秀程序了。...常见二十多种设计模式 在架构层面,也有一些常见架构模式或风格,如分层架构,领域驱动设计模式,六边型架构模式等 程序需要理解这些原则与模式,更重要是在日常编码过程中,不断应用与实践它们。...下一篇,编码之道(终): 做专业程序

    45520

    视觉进阶 | 用于图像降噪卷积自编码

    这个标准神经网络用于图像数据,比较简单。这解释了处理图像数据时为什么首选是卷积自编码器。最重要是,我将演示卷积自编码器如何减少图像噪声。这篇文章将用上Keras模块和MNIST数据。...MNIST MNIST数据库是一个大型手写数字数据库,通常用于训练各种图像处理系统。Keras训练数据集具备60,000条记录,而测试数据集则包含了10,000条记录。...,用于训练 如果要让神经网络框架适用于模型训练,我们可以在一列中堆叠所有28 x 28 = 784个值。...答案是肯定。图像中空间关系被忽略了。这使得大量信息丢失。那么,我们接着看卷积自编码器如何保留空间信息。 图(B) 为什么图像数据首选卷积自编码器?...中间部分是一个完全连接自动编码器,其隐藏层仅由10个神经元组成。然后就是解码过程。三个立方体将会展平,最后变成2D平面图像。图(D)编码器和解码器是对称。实际上,编码器和解码器不要求对称。

    71710

    不可取代程序编码方式!!!

    背景 在一家公司呆了两年了,作为工作十多年程序来说,真心感觉这两年时间是真的长,每天上班如上坟,度日如年。...一天无意中跟周边同事闲聊,我说这项目代码这么差你们怎么度过来,他们一副若无其事样子,一个平日走比较近同学悄悄告诉我,这边项目负责人都换了好几波了,当时真的快自闭了......4.很多人都会提到代码Review,一般公司千万不要被唬住,按我过往经验来看,大部分leader只关注你在时候会不会出问题,只要保持第一版本抗住线上不出大逻辑问题,那就基本通关;日常中即便leader...管比较严格也是有方法哦,比如可以适当刻意把问题描述尽可能复杂,然后工作周期还要拼短一点,表示你在很努力很敢节奏一副很想把需求做好样子,真正review时候给leader真诚反馈,下个迭代我会把这些细节问题都优化掉...只要这块代码真的核心,兄弟,日后你就是捅娄子了,leader也还是会有所忌惮。看看我们这边小伙伴就做足够好,要背锅只能是领导!!!

    23830

    WACV 2023 | ImPosing:用于视觉定位隐式姿态编码

    通过以分层方式在潜在空间来评估候选者,相机位置和方向不是直接回归,而是逐渐细化。算法占存储量非常紧凑且与参考数据库大小无关。...训练是在带有相机姿态label数据库图像上进行训练,没有用额外场景3D模型。 先通过图像编码器计算表示图像向量。然后通过评估分布在地图上初始姿态候选来搜索相机姿态。...姿态编码器对相机姿态进行处理以产生可以与图像向量相匹配潜在表示,每个候选姿态都会有一个基于到相机姿态距离分数。高分提供了用于选择新候选者粗略定位先验。...因此可以在千米级地图中收敛到精确姿态估计,同时只评估有限稀疏姿态集。在每个时间步长独立评估每个相机帧,但可以使用以前时间步长定位先验来减少车辆导航场景中迭代次数。...通过提供一种高效准确基于图像定位算法,该算法可以实时大规模操作,使其可以直接应用于自动驾驶系统。 但是方法准确性在很大程度上取决于可用训练数据数量。

    26030

    视觉进阶 | 用于图像降噪卷积自编码

    这个标准神经网络用于图像数据,比较简单。这解释了处理图像数据时为什么首选是卷积自编码器。最重要是,我将演示卷积自编码器如何减少图像噪声。这篇文章将用上Keras模块和MNIST数据。...MNIST MNIST数据库是一个大型手写数字数据库,通常用于训练各种图像处理系统。Keras训练数据集具备60,000条记录,而测试数据集则包含了10,000条记录。...图像数据堆叠,用于训练 如果要让神经网络框架适用于模型训练,我们可以在一列中堆叠所有28 x 28 = 784个值。...答案是肯定。图像中空间关系被忽略了。这使得大量信息丢失。那么,我们接着看卷积自编码器如何保留空间信息。 ? 图(B) 为什么图像数据首选卷积自编码器?...中间部分是一个完全连接自动编码器,其隐藏层仅由10个神经元组成。然后就是解码过程。三个立方体将会展平,最后变成2D平面图像。图(D)编码器和解码器是对称。实际上,编码器和解码器不要求对称。 ?

    1.3K40

    java 字符串编码转换 字符集编码见解 心得 体会(跟之前那个C++编码随笔对应)

    Java要转换字符编码:就一个String.getBytes("charsetName")解决,返回字节数组已经是新编码了~~至于后边是new String组装还是网络发送,就再处理了。...编码关键是要理解最底层那个字节数组是怎么编码,例如GB2312用两个字节表示一个汉字,UTF8用三个字节表示一个汉字,可见,底层字节数组肯定有不同~~~ !!!...Java要转换字符编码:就一个String.getBytes("charsetName")解决,这时候已经把原来String字节数组逐个字符转化了,此时编码已经变了。...而new String只是一个组装String过程,传入字节数组是什么编码,就该用什么编码组装(或者叫解释),不然就悲剧了~~~ !!!...虽然程序默认编码是UTF8,这不代表程序中用GB2312编码字符串就无法正确显示。(这是我个人之前误解)因为out.println时候,系统会自动处理。

    2.4K30

    编码秘籍,Java程序必看调试技巧

    调试可以帮助我们识别和解决应用程序缺陷,老九君下面介绍调试方法基本都是通用,有了下面的这些技巧在开发中会让我们在编程中事半功倍,避免浪费时间!...3.监视点 这是一个非常好功能,当选定属性访问或修改程序时,程序会停止执行并允许进行调试。...4.评估/检查 按Ctrl+Shift+D或者Ctrl+Shift+I来显示选定变量或者表达式值。...根据回档调整堆栈深度,这个功能主要用途是所有变量状态可以快速回到方法开始执行时候样子,然后我们可以重新进行一遍一遍执行,这样就可以在我们关注地方进行多次调试,但是在执行过程中也会产生一些副作用,...老九君认为平时多积累找到属于自己方法才是最好技巧!

    87160

    编码时易忽略坏习惯-优化编码(仅用于个人学习,不喜勿喷--持续更新)

    c)在 JDK8 中,针对统计时间等场景,建议使用 Instant 类。...编码时易犯一些小毛病  毛病一:变量作为 equals() 方法调用方。...反例: 正解:类似的这种问题,多数程序都犯过。记录日志时占位符少,而参数值多,日志输出时想打印参数,日志中却没有打印。...谷歌 Guava 工具包也不错,该类库经过高度优化,方便我们快速编码,能规避不少编码错误。 毛病二:完成对象间属性 Copy,编写冗长代码。...寄语写最后  精妙代码简洁明了,如果将这个代码给其他程序看,他们会说:“哇,这代码写得真好。”那感觉很像在写一首诗。 我等采石之人当心怀大教堂之愿景——《程序修炼之道》。

    54230

    Bioinformatics | MICER: 用于分子图像字幕预训练编码-解码架构

    该文章受编码器-解码器架构启发,提出了MICER分子图像识别架构,结合迁移学习、注意力机制和几种数据构造策略增强不同数据集有效性和可塑性;并评估了不同因素对该架构影响以及数据集错误分析,为后续研究提供方向...但目前研究不足,存在局限性,因此没有得到充分利用。 结果 MICER是一个基于编码器-解码器用于分子图像识别的重构架构,它结合了迁移学习、注意机制和几种策略,以加强不同数据集有效性和可塑性。...评估了立体化学信息、分子复杂性、数据量和预训练编码器对MICER性能影响。实验结果表明,分子图像内在特征和子模型匹配对该任务性能有很大影响。...(a) MICER模型概述。(b) 实验数据预处理。(c) 模型一般结构。(d) 注意机制例子。...图5 注意力权重图示 4 总结 本文中,作者介绍了一种基于编码器-解码器架构,称为MICER,用于分子图像字幕,具有良好可塑性。MICER结合了迁移学习和注意力机制。

    44520
    领券